NettetTHE ACL TEAR. Last but certainly not least, ACL tears occur often in both football players and other athletes. The most common major knee injury to occur in football is a rupture of the ACL (anterior cruciate ligament). The ACL is the most important structure preventing the tibia bone from moving too far forward of the femur bone. Nettet8. des. 2024 · An ACL tear often happens in dynamic sports like basketball, soccer, and football. A strong indicator of an ACL tear is the presence of snapping or popping sounds when the injury occurs. The reason this sound occurs is because the ligament is very strong, thus creating a loud snap when it tears. NettetFor example, an ACL tear often occurs along with tears to the MCL and the shock-absorbing cartilage in the knee (meniscus). Most ACL tears occur in the middle of the ligament, or the ligament is pulled off the thigh bone. These injuries form a gap between the torn edges, and do not heal on their own. Symptoms. NettetACL injuries most commonly occur during sports that involve sudden stops, changes in direction, and jumping— such as soccer, football, basketball, volleyball, and downhill … Nettet28. aug. 2024 · Surprisingly to most, more ACL tears occur due to non-contact mechanisms versus those when the knee is hit. Approximately 60-70% of ACL tears are non-contact injuries. This means that about 2/3 of ACL tears happen due to preventable biomechanical movement errors.
